zoukankan      html  css  js  c++  java
  • iOS友盟推送测试模式添加手机设备报红解决如下

    设备描述红色一般是没有往友盟发日志,或者appkey漏掉了。
    先检查是否正确的填写了推送的appkey,统计的方法为MobClick startWithAppkey;推送的方法为UMessage startWithAppkey 是两个不同的方法。

    如果还是不行IOS首先用以下代码判断有木有错误:

    didFailToRegisterForRemoteNotificationsWithError:(NSError *)err
    {
        
        NSString *error_str = [NSString stringWithFormat: @"%@", err];
        NSLog(@"Failed to get token, error:%@", error_str);
        
    }
    同时:
    - (void)application:(UIApplication *)application didRegisterForRemoteNotificationsWithDeviceToken:(NSData *)deviceToken
    {
        [UMessage registerDeviceToken:deviceToken];
        
        NSLog(@"didRegisterForRemoteNotificationsWithDeviceToken success");
        
        NSLog(@"%@",[[[[deviceToken description] stringByReplacingOccurrencesOfString: @"<" withString: @""]
                      stringByReplacingOccurrencesOfString: @">" withString: @""]
                     stringByReplacingOccurrencesOfString: @" " withString: @""]);
        
    }

      其中[UMessage registerDeviceToken:deviceToken];不能注释掉。
    如果还是不行的话,可以再次对app进行卸载重装。

    然后再到友盟应用上添加测试设备就好了

  • 相关阅读:
    js splice 属性实现数组的删除,插入,替换
    js var多等式变量的定义
    SQL Server 收缩数据库
    sql2005 全文索引
    显示器分辨率推荐
    使用javascript打开链接的多种方法
    运算优先级
    jqGrid
    asp.net IE 页面刷新固定位置
    Left Join ,On Where
  • 原文地址:https://www.cnblogs.com/sunfuyou/p/6952597.html
Copyright © 2011-2022 走看看